5) Arbitrary file upload

EUVDB-ID: #VU8796

Risk: Low

CVSSv3.1: 5.1 [C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:C/C:N/I:L/A:N/E:U/RL:O/RC:C]

CVE-ID: CVE-2017-8025

CWE-ID: CWE-20 - Improper input validation

Exploit availability: No

Description

The vulnerability allows a remote attacker to upload arbitrary files.

The weakness exists due to insufficient sanitization of user-supplied data. A remote attacker can upload malicious files via attachments to arbitrary paths on the web server.

Mitigation

Update to version 6.2.0.5.

Vulnerable software versions

RSA Archer: 6.2.0.0 - 6.2.0.4

6) Privilege escalation

EUVDB-ID: #VU8797

Risk: Low

CVSSv3.1: 5.5 [CVSS:3.1/AV:N/AC:L/PR:L/UI:N/S:U/C:L/I:L/A:L/E:U/RL:O/RC:C]

CVE-ID: CVE-2017-14369

CWE-ID: CWE-264 - Permissions, Privileges, and Access Controls

Exploit availability: No

Description

The vulnerability allows a remote authenticated attacker to gain elevated privileges on the target system.

The weakness exists due to improper access and privilege controls. A remote attacker can elevate privileges and export certain application records.

Mitigation

Update to version 6.2.0.5.

Vulnerable software versions

RSA Archer: 6.2.0.0 - 6.2.0.4
